    182 brake caliper slider pins seized in! arghhhh

    Last set of slider pins I had that were seized, I held the pin in a vice and just rotated the carrier back and forth on it. Came off after a fair bit of effort! I think the grease you'd be after would be something silicone based. I've used lithium grease before though without any problems...

    182 Dashboard Lights

    Tell him to get the ABS ring replaced and see if the fault goes away. Don't change the ABS sensors unless you know they're at fault. They're bloody expensive on clios with ESP! All faults relating to the ABS system are self clearing iirc so if the problem is fixed, the lights will go off.
